VIDEO: Driver treated for overdose after 91原创 crash

First responders dealt with a three-vehicle collision Tuesday.

Paramedics reportedly administered Narcan to one driver in a multi-vehicle crash that tied up 200th Street and 72nd Avenue during the Tuesday night rush hour.

Just before 6 p.m., a multi-vehicle crash took place at the intersection, involving a semi-trailer tractor, an SUV, and a small car, according to a witness.

The driver of the car was not responsive or breathing, but revived when given Narcan. Narcan is a drug used to revive people who have suffered opioid overdoses.

91原创 RCMP are investigating.
